Qingdao Port breaks world record for 7 years in a row SPG 2023-02-17 10:37

The Qingdao Qianwan Container terminal (QQCT), a unit of Qingdao Port, recently set a new global vessel productivity record of 422.38 moves per hour while handling Maersk's Latin America service vessel MAERSK SALINA. This was the second time QQCT broke the global shipping route record since the beginning of 2022.
 
Consistently breaking global service records isn't new for Qingdao Port. According to port officials, by the end of 2022, Qingdao Port had remained in first place in vessel productivity among global container ports of call where Maersk vessels berth for seven consecutive years. In the process of smashing global records, Qingdao Port has formed a standard service mode.
 
To organize production resources in a more reasonable and efficient way in daily port operations, berth planners may allocate workers and cargo-handling equipment deployed for vessels in advance. This can make the organization of port production more forward-looking and guarantee the achievement of target plans.
 
Data show that QQCT's single-crane efficiency increased by 4.5 percent year-on-year in 2022. Its berth productivity for 8,000-TEU container ships witnessed a year-on-year increase of 1.8 percent and its planned vessel achievement rate increased by 3 percent. Last year, the terminal broke a total of 17 production records in new shipping routes, single-ship handling, single-work shifts and single work-days.
 
As shorter time means higher productivity, vessel-at-berth time and non-working waiting time are two critical factors for container terminals and ocean carriers. To significantly shorten the length of time ships spend at berth, QQCT has continuously optimized its cargo-stowage plans. According to data provided by the terminal's planning room, in 2022 non-working waiting time for vessels at QQCT declined by 50 percent and overall berth waiting time decreased by at least 50 percent.
